Box Score 2 G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. - Today the Calvin University softball team took on the Ravens of Anderson where they picked up two wins. After today's games the Knight improved to an overall record of 24-8 while Anderson fell to 6-19.

GAME 1
CALVIN 9, ANDERSON 0
Â
In the first game of the day the Knights jumped out to a quick lead in the bottom of the first inning when
Carly Dole (Mt. Pleasant, Mich./Mt. Pleasant) hammered a two-run homerun over the right field fence to score
Grace Glass (Indianapolis, Ind./North Central) and give Calvin the 2-0 lead.

The Knights kept the momentum rolling in the second inning when
Kennedi Pepin (Bourbonnais, Ill./Bradley Bourbonnais) forced a walk to give Calvin a baserunner. Next up,
Sage Mougin (New Carlisle, Ind./New Prairie) beat out a bunt to move Pepin into scoring position. Two batters later freshman
Aubrey Herder (Kalamazoo, Mich./Kalamazoo Christian) punched the ball through the infield to score the run and extend the Calvin lead.

Calvin tacked on two more runs in the fourth inning thanks to RBIs from
Lily Gaastra (Grand Rapids, Mich./Grand Rapids Christian) and Herder to make the score 5-0. In the bottom of the fifth inning,
Taylor Sanborn (Midland, Mich./Midland) kicked things off with a single up the middle before
Emilie Gist (Bettendorf, Iowa/Bettendorf) followed it up with a single of her own. Next,
Tory Decker (Hudsonville, Mich./Unity Christian) stepped into the batter's box and delivered a single through the left side to score pinch runner
Emily Sweetland (Ann Arbor, Mich./Saline) and boost the Calvin lead. The Knights rounded out their scoring that inning when
Alanna Garcia (Holt, Mich./Holt) sent a long fly ball to left field to score pinch runner
Mya Brickley (Battle Creek, Mich./Delton Kellogg) and make the score 7-0.

In the bottom of the sixth inning the Knight continued to put pressure on the Raven defense when
Ella Steele (San Jose, Calif./Valley Christian) and
Emma Springer (Three Oaks, Mich./River Valley) hit back-to-back singles to kick things off. Two batters later, Gist called game with a two run double to give Calvin the 9-0 victory after just six innings.

In the circle, sophomore
Brooke Hunderman (Grand Rapids, Mich./Calvin Christian) continued to show her dominance as she recorded twelve strikes while only giving up one hit.

GAME 2
CALVIN 2, ANDERSON 1

In the second game of the day the first scoring opportunity came for the Knights when Herder doubled down the left field line to start the bottom of the third inning. On the next play, Dole hit her seventeenth triple of the season to score Herder before Sanborn followed with a single to bring in Dole and give Calvin the 2-0 lead.

Offensively, things were quite for both teams after that as junior
Zoe Hazelhoff (Kalamazoo, Mich./Kalamazoo Christian) dominated in the circle. She recorded three strikeouts while her defense made some spectacular plays as she stayed perfect through six innings. In the top of the seventh, the Ravens picked up their first hit of the game before pushing one run across the plate and cutting the Calvin lead down to one. With Anderson threatening,
Emma Ludema (Martin, Mich./Wayland) entered the game with bases loaded and recorded the final out to get the save while Hazelhoff was credited with the 2-1 win.

COACHES COMMENTS: "Really impressed with Anderson's fight as they had some travel issues and we had to push things back," said head coach
Becky Hilgert. "They played really well and didn't let the long day impact him. Brooke was efficient in game one and we were able to finally support her with some big runs. In game two, Zoe was also efficient and our defense made plays behind her. Emma came in relief in a tough situation and closed the door which is just like we practice. Really great staff day by her pitchers. Overall, two good team wins."
